Abstract
For the Deaf and Dumb community, the use of Information and Communication Technology has increased the ease of life for them. Deaf and dumb people communicate with help of sign language to pass their messages to each other. In this way, they can’t express their ideas the exact way, they want. The paper illustrates implementation of STT and TTS technique for deaf and dumb people to make them communicate better. In this paper, we have compared elaborated research work done in the same field which may be helpful in identifying the drawbacks as well as methods to improvise the present technology. This paper presents a detailed methodology used in numerous research work and advancements for the deaf and dumb community.
